The Association of School and College Leaders (ASCL) is a leading professional body representing more than 25,000 school and college leaders across the UK and we're looking to appoint a new team member.

Hybrid working - a combination of working from home and being in-person at our Leicester office (frequency to be agreed at interview)

ASCL is seeking to appoint a qualified solicitor looking for a unique opportunity to work in-house as part of a dynamic and vibrant team in a hybrid working environment.

This is an exciting opportunity to join our experienced legal department. Working with a team of solicitors, the successful candidate will report directly to ASCL's Senior Solicitor. The legal department is responsible for providing advice and representation for the organisation and its members, who are senior leaders within the education sector. If successful, you will be able to experience a range of work including (but not limited to) providing advice to members involved in internal processes with their employers, employment tribunal litigation, representing members involved in professional discipline cases before their regulators, inquests and public inquiries. Candidates must be a qualified employment solicitor and will ideally have 1-5 years PQE.

This post is based at ASCL HQ in Leicester with remote working available. The post-holder will be required to work at HQ for a minimum of three-days per week and when requested to do so. Occasional overnight stays may also be required.

This role is paid on a five-point incremental range from £46,771 to £51,430. Reasonable travel and out-of-pocket expenses are also covered.

ASCL is an equal opportunities employer and offers a very generous package of benefits, including 33 days holiday plus bank holidays and a pension scheme to which the association contributes 9%.
